3.1.4.21.8.2.4 Queue

Property Identifier

Queue attribute

Computation

PROPID_Q_INSTANCE ([MS-MQMQ] section 2.3.1.1

Identifier

SHOULD be treated as invalid.<92>

PROPID_Q_TYPE ([MS-MQMQ] section 2.3.1.2)

Type

GUID copied from property.

PROPID_Q_PATHNAME ([MS-MQMQ] section 2.3.1.3)

Pathname

SHOULD be ignored.<93>

PROPID_Q_JOURNAL ([MS-MQMQ] section 2.3.1.4)

Journaling

If property is 0x01, set QueueManager.Journaling to TRUE; Else set to FALSE.

PROPID_Q_QUOTA ([MS-MQMQ] section 2.3.1.5)

Quota

Integer copied from property.

PROPID_Q_BASEPRIORITY ([MS-MQMQ] section 2.3.1.6)

BasePriority

Integer copied from property.

PROPID_Q_JOURNAL_QUOTA ([MS-MQMQ] section 2.3.1.7)

JournalQuota

Integer copied from property.

PROPID_Q_LABEL ([MS-MQMQ] section 2.3.1.8)

Label

NULL-terminated 16-bit Unicode string copied from property.

PROPID_Q_CREATE_TIME ([MS-MQMQ] section 2.3.1.9)

CreateTime

SHOULD be treated as invalid.<94>

PROPID_Q_MODIFY_TIME ([MS-MQMQ] section 2.3.1.10)

ModifyTime

Set by server on write. If this property is supplied, it MUST be treated as invalid.

PROPID_Q_AUTHENTICATE ([MS-MQMQ] section 2.3.1.11)

Authentication

If property is 0x01, set Queue.Authentication to TRUE; Else set to FALSE.

PROPID_Q_PRIV_LEVEL ([MS-MQMQ] section 2.3.1.12)

PrivacyLevel

See section 3.1.4.21.8.2.5.

PROPID_Q_TRANSACTION ([MS-MQMQ] section 2.3.1.13)

Transactional

If property is 0x01, set Queue.Transactional to TRUE; Else set to FALSE

PROPID_Q_QMID ([MS-MQMQ] section 2.3.1.15)

QueueManagerIdentifier

GUID copied from property.

PROPID_Q_PARTITIONID ([MS-MQMQ] section 2.3.1.16)

PartitionIdentifier

GUID copied from property.

PROPID_Q_NAME_SUFFIX ([MS-MQMQ] section 2.3.1.21)

PathnameSuffix

NULL-terminated 16-bit Unicode string copied from property.

PROPID_Q_PATHNAME_DNS ([MS-MQMQ] section 2.3.1.22)

QualifiedPathname

MUST be ignored.

PROPID_Q_SCOPE ([MS-MQMQ] section 2.3.1.14)

Scope

If property is 0x01, set Queue.Scope to Enterprise; Else if property is 0x00 set Queue.Scope to Site.

PROPID_Q_SEQNUM ([MS-MQMQ] section 2.3.1.17)

SequenceNumber

MAY be unused.<95>